Today we have a chance to change the lives of hundreds of American families, including three families in the Sixth District of Kentucky. One of these is the Hatton family, who are sitting in the gallery here today. These families have legally adopted children from the Democratic Republic of Congo, but have been unable to bring their children home because their exit permits have been unfairly halted. After learning of their struggles, I have been working closely with the Department of State and advocating on their behalf because no family should be faced with the choice of leaving the newest member of their family in another country or remaining in the Congo, further splitting up their family and causing a tremendous amount of uncertainty and heartache. We must do everything in our power to help these American citizens and facilitate the travel of their adopted children home to join their family in the United States. That is why I am a cosponsor of this resolution and thank the member from Minnesota for his leadership and support on this issue.
